Electric Light Orchestra’s (ELO) legendary keyboardist Richard Tandy has sadly passed away at the age of 76. Jeff Lynne, the band’s frontman, expressed his profound grief over losing a ‘dear friend’ and long-time collaborator.
Taking to Facebook on Wednesday (May 1), Lynne penned an emotional tribute saying, “It is with great sadness that I share the news of the passing of my long-time collaborator and dear friend Richard Tandy.”
He continued, “He was a remarkable musician and friend and I’ll cherish the lifetime of memories we had together. Sending all my love to Sheila and the Tandy Family.”
